Claims
- 1. An audio message recording and duplicating system for enabling a perfected message to be recorded and then transferred onto an audio generating circuit/module for being replayed when activated, said recording and duplicating system comprising:A. a re-recordable audio receiving and producing member a. constructed for enabling any desired audio message to be recorded thereon, and b. enabling the review, deletion and re-recording of any message as desired by the user; B. first connector means mounted to the audio receiving and producing member for enabling at least one audio generating circuit/module to be interconnected therewith; C. transmission means connected to the re-recordable audio receiving/producing member and constructed for receiving the audio message therefrom and transmitting the audio message to the first connector means when desired by the user; and D. a separate and independent audio generating circuit or module a. constructed for receiving the audio message stored in the re-recordable audio receiving and producing member and storing the identical audio signal or message therein, b. generating the audio signal/message when activated, and c. incorporating a second connector constructed for mating engagement with the first connector means and enabling the receipt and transfer of the audio message from the audio receiving/producing member to the audio generating circuit/module for storage in said audio generating circuit/module, whereby any desired audio message may be recorded and perfected on the re-recordable audio receiving/producing means and, once perfected, transferred to the audio generating circuit/module for being played whenever desired.
- 2. The audio recording system defined in claim 1, wherein said audio generating circuit/module comprises a one-time programmable, audio generating circuit/module.
- 3. The audio recording system defined in claim 2, wherein said audio generating circuit/module comprises audio storage means formed therein for receiving, recording and retaining an audio message for playback when activated.
- 4. The audio recording system defined in claim 1, wherein the re-recordable audio receiving and producing means comprises one selected from the group consisting of a computer, a central processing unit and a separate stand-alone unit.
- 5. The audio recording system defined in claim 4, wherein the docking station and the first connecter means comprises an interface member.
- 6. The audio recording system defined in claim 1, wherein the audio generating circuit/module is defined as comprising:A. an integrated circuit formed in a supporting circuit board and incorporating electronic components for receiving and storing an audio signal and re-playing the audio signal in response to receipt of an activation signal; B. a switch member for producing an activating signal to cause the circuit to produce the stored audio signal; C. power means connected to the circuit for enabling the circuit to be activated; and D. a second connector formed on the circuit board and interconnected to the electronic components for enabling the electronic interconnection thereof.
- 7. The audio message recording and duplicating system defined in claim 1, wherein said first connector means is further defined as comprising a plurality of pin receiving zones for enabling the rapid engagement therewith of one selected from the group consisting of a single audio generating circuit/module and a plurality of audio generating circuits/modules.
- 8. The audio message recording and duplicating system defined in claim 1, wherein the re-recordable audio receiving and producing member comprises a microprocessor constructed for receiving analog and digital audio messages and recording and storing said audio messages in a digital format.
- 9. The audio message recording and duplicating system defined in claim 8, wherein the re-recordable audio receiving and producing member incorporates a plurality of switch means for enabling audio messages of different time intervals to be designated and recorded.
- 10. The audio message recording and duplicating system defined in claim 1, wherein said re-recordable audio receiving and producing member comprises a first switch for initiating the transfer of a recorded message to the audio generating circuit/module and a second switch for enabling playback of a recorded message.
- 11. An audio message recording and duplicating system for enabling a perfected message to be recorded onto an audio generating circuit/module for being replayed when activated, said recording and duplicating system comprising:A. a re-recordable audio receiving and producing member a. constructed for enabling any desired audio message to be recorded thereon, and b. enabling the review, deletion and re-recording of any message as desired by the user; B. first connector means mounted to the audio receiving and producing member and constructed for enabling a plurality of separate and independent audio generating circuits/modules to be simultaneously mounted therein and be interconnected therewith; C. transmission means connected to the re-recordable audio receiving/producing member and constructed for receiving the audio message therefrom and simultaneously transmitting the audio message to the first connector means and to each of the plurality of audio generating circuits/modules when desired by the user; and D. a plurality of separate and independent audio generating circuits or modules, each being a. constructed for receiving and storing an audio signal or message, b. generating the audio signal/message when activated, and c. incorporating a second connector constructed for mating engagement with the first connector means and enabling the receipt and transfer of the audio message from the audio receiving/producing member to the audio generating circuit/module; whereby any desired audio message may be recorded and perfected on the re-recordable audio receiving/producing member and, once perfected, transferred to the plurality of audio generating circuits/modules for being stored therein in a single operation.
- 12. The audio message recording and duplicating system defined in claim 11, wherein each of said audio generating circuits/modules comprise a one-time programmable, audio generating circuit/module.
- 13. The audio message recording and duplicating system defined in claim 12, wherein each of said audio generating circuits/modules comprises audio storage means formed therein for receiving, recording and retaining an audio message for playback when activated.
- 14. The audio message recording and duplicating system defined in claim 11, wherein each of the plurality of audio generating circuits/modules is defined as comprising:A. an integrated circuit formed in a supporting circuit board and incorporating electronic components for receiving and storing an audio signal and re-playing the audio signal in response to receipt of an activation signal; B. a switch member for producing an activating signal to cause the circuit to produce the stored audio signal; C. power means connected to the circuit for enabling the circuit to be activated; and D. a second connector formed on the circuit board and interconnected to the electronic components for enabling the electronic interconnection thereof.
- 15. The audio message recording and duplicating system defined in claim 11, wherein the plurality of audio generating circuits/modules are mounted in a support member with each audio generating circuit/module positioned in juxtaposed, spaced relationship to an adjacent audio generating circuit/module, with the second connector each audio generating circuit/module being positioned for ease of access and engagement with the first connector.
- 16. The audio message recording and duplicating system defined in claim 15, wherein said support member is further defined as comprising, at least in part, a shipping container for said plurality of audio generating circuits/modules.
- 17. The audio message recording and duplicating system defined in claim 15, wherein said second connector is defined as being mounted to the top edge of each audio generating circuit/module.
- 18. The audio message recording and duplicating system defined in claim 15, wherein said support member comprises a substantially flat panel construction for receiving and retaining the plurality of audio generating circuits/modules therein by peripherally surrounding each module on three of its four side edges, with the free edge incorporating the second connector.
- 19. The audio message recording and duplicating system defined in claim 15, wherein said system further comprises an interface constructed for engaging with the first connector of the audio receiving and producing member and for simultaneously engaging with the second connector of each of the plurality of audio generating circuits/modules, whereby the message retained on the audio receiving and producing member is simultaneously transferred to each of the plurality of audio generating circuits/modules.
- 20. The audio message recording and duplicating system defined in claim 19, wherein said interface is further defined as comprising a separate and independent LED positioned in association with each of the plurality of audio generating circuits/modules, and constructed for monitoring and providing a visual indication of the progress and completion of the transfer of the desired message from the re-recordable audio receiving and producing member to the associated audio generating circuit/modules.
- 21. An audio message recording and duplicating system for enabling a perfected message to be recorded and then transferred onto an audio generating circuit/module for being replayed when activated, said recording and duplicating system comprising:A. a re-recordable audio receiving and producing member constructed for enabling any desired audio message to be recorded thereon, and enabling the review, deletion and re-recording of any message as desired by the user, said re-recordable audio receiving and producing member comprising: a. a microprocessor constructed or receiving analog and digital audio messages and recording and storing said audio messages in a digital format; b. a first switch for initiating the transfer of a recorded message to an audio generating circuit/module and a second switch for enabling playback of a recorded message; and c. at least a third switch and a fourth switch for enabling audio messages of different time intervals to be designated and recorded; B. first connector means mounted to the audio receiving and producing member for enabling at least one audio generating circuit/module to be interconnected therewith; C. transmission means connected to the re-recordable audio receiving/producing member and constructed for receiving the audio message therefrom and transmitting the audio message to the first connector means when desired by the user; and D. a separate and independent audio generating circuit or module a. constructed for receiving the audio message stored in the re-recordable audio receiving and producing member and storing the identical audio signal or message therein, b. generating the audio signal/message when activated, and c. incorporating a second connector constructed for mating engagement with the first connector means and enabling the receipt and transfer of the audio message from the audio receiving/producing member to the audio generating circuit/module for storage in said audio generating circuit/module, whereby any desired audio message may be recorded and perfected on the re-recordable audio receiving/producing means and, once perfected, transferred to the audio generating circuit/module for being played whenever desired.
